## Changed defaults — Waveform preview

The Soundloom waveform preview now renders at 200 samples per pixel instead of 400, and peak caching is enabled by default. This roughly halves first-paint time for long recordings at the cost of slightly larger cache entries. Downsampling mode switched from average to min-max to preserve transients. No API changes; existing callers get the new behavior automatically. The new default configuration shipped with this release is as follows.

settings of kageg-yawig:
[casix]
host = casix.tolvaqlabs.corp
user = casix_svc
database = casix_prod

Onboarding note for the Ledgerpane admin table: bulk edits are applied through the batcher service, not directly against the database. Select rows, choose an action, and the batcher stages changes in a pending set you can review before commit. Edits over 500 rows require a second approver — this is enforced server-side, so don't try to chunk around it. To run the batcher locally you need the staging write credential, which goes in your .env as the next line.

secret setting of bahip-kagag: RELAY_SECRET3=c83

## Deploying the Gatewick Proctor Queue

Deploys are pretty painless: push to main, wait for the pipeline, then watch the queue drain dashboard for five minutes. If candidates pile up mid-exam, roll back first and ask questions later — the queue replays safely. Everything the workers care about lives in one config block, shown here for reference.

settings of bafof-yagef:
JOROX_PIN=8740
JOROX_TENANT=pelox
JOROX_METRICS_HOST=metrics.jorox.qorvelworks.internal
JOROX_SEAL=seal_c78f63c1
JOROX_STANDBY_TEAM=norax

### Key Ceremony Checklist — Item 7: WebSocket Compression Review

Before sealing the Fernbrook release keys, double-check that permessage-deflate stays off for the realtime feed. Yes, compression saves bandwidth, but it spikes CPU on the edge boxes and we got burned last quarter — latency beats byte savings here. Confirm the config flag, note it in the ceremony log, then unlock the escrow vault. The vault prompt expects the recovery passphrase recorded on the line below.

unlock words, fafop-hawep: briwyn-oliix-sorox